A a UCUO' i . 1 1 g , , f L to R3 Top to Bottom: COMSIXTHFLT holds Admiral's call on the flight deck. VADM Train noted TRUETT's achievements with KIEV and the Middle East. COMDESRON 22 also visited TRUETT. Rota, Spain, is a major U.S. submarine base. VADM Train meets BMC Albert Windham Jr. in Chief's Quarters. COMSIXTHFLT's barge departs TRUETT for his flagship, USS ALBANY. COMDESRON 22 presents TM1 John Marston with DESRON 22 Sailor of the Year. Two views of the Gaeta countryside show a farmer tending his fields and the local beaches.

A? t f fri L to Fig Top Row: USS QONYNGHAM's greeting was intending for the families on the pier but served to welcome V TRUETT also. OC Division stands at Quarters to starboard coming into port. Looking past the fantail of USS THOMAS C. HART the Navy band is seen striking up a tune. Once quarters was broken the flight deck and fantail seemed too small to hold everyone who wanted to await the visitors. Bottom Row: This series shows home approaching as seen from the viewpoint of the TRUETT sailor. In order: Passing the - bridge-tunnelj The piers in sightg Flag India close up on USS CONYNGHAMQ The band strikes up as the bow comes even with CONYNGHAlVl's sterng Line one is over and the families greet TRUETT with a sign.
